Smothered Yellow Squash With Basil

 

2 tablespoons olive oil

1 1/2 pounds medium yellow squash, halved lengthwise and cut crosswise into 1/8

inch thick slices

2 garlic cloves, finely chopped

1/2 cup water

1/4 teaspoon salt

1/8 teaspoon black pepper

1/4 cup finely chopped fresh basil

 

Heat 1 tablespoon oil in a 12-inch heavy skillet over moderately high heat

until hot but not smoking, then add half of squash and saute, stirring

occasionally, until browned, about 5 minutes. Transfer browned squash to a bowl,

then heat remaining tablespoon oil and saute remaining squash in same manner.

Transfer browned squash to a bowl, then heat remaining tablespoon oil and saute

remaining squash in same manner. Return squash in bowl to skillet. Add garlic

and saute, stirring occasionally, 1 minute. Add water, salt and pepper and

simmer briskly, covered, until squash is tender and most of liquid is

evaporated, 6 to 7 minutes. Stir in basil. Serves 4.
